Special Purpose Machines have evolved from niche custom setups to high-performance, precision-driven systems built for specific manufacturing tasks.
Modern SPMs focus on maximizing productivity, reducing cycle time, and eliminating repetitive manual processes. With tailored mechanisms and automation integration, these machines deliver unmatched consistency and throughput for high-volume operations.
Advancements such as servo-controlled assemblies, intelligent monitoring systems, and modular machine platforms allow manufacturers to achieve faster changeovers and tighter tolerances. These innovations increase output quality, minimize human intervention, and create a more stable, predictable production environment.
Successful SPM deployment starts with strong planning—analyzing workflow gaps, defining task-specific requirements, and designing a machine that solves those bottlenecks precisely. With the right strategy, SPMs remove inefficiencies, speed up operations, and offer a long-term competitive advantage by delivering consistent, high-speed performance tailored to the application.
